Output e667d9ce116538b3cdca723e72ce7c3f1cdf409307c1eae3f9619eff2c14d173:2

value
461777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44c38a77d098bb5b7b2a28fe82a2f28c3aed0440 OP_EQUAL
address
37xc81PUF9E5FLkamEPXq98dJZfmkFkZV4
transaction
e667d9ce116538b3cdca723e72ce7c3f1cdf409307c1eae3f9619eff2c14d173
confirmations
125263
spent
true